About Blind Professionals Network (BPN)

Blind Professionals Network (BPN)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ization dedicated to empowering blind and visually impaired (BVI) individuals to achieve professional success. We provide free career development, specialized training, and a vital peer network to break down employment barriers.

Position Summary

The mentoring Program Manager is a pivotal leadership volunteer role responsible for the design, execution, and oversight of BPN’s mentorship initiatives. This role manages two primary pillars: the core BPN Mentorship Program (matching seasoned professionals with mentees) and the Peer-To-Peer Empowerment Partnership Program (facilitating collaborative growth between peers). The Manager ensures that all participants are supported, resources are accessible, and the programs effectively move the needle on BVI professional advancement.

Key Responsibilities

Mentorship Program Management:

  • Matching & Onboarding: Oversee the application process for mentors and mentees; strategically pair individuals based on career goals, industry, and specific needs.
  • Relationship Tracking: Monitor the progress of mentorship pairs through regular check-ins to ensure goals are being met and the relationship remains productive.
  • Resource Development: Create and distribute "Mentorship Toolkits" to provide structure, icebreakers, and goal-setting frameworks for participants using accessible document formats.

Peer-To-Peer Empowerment Partnership Management:

  • Program Oversight: Facilitate the Peer-To-Peer Empowerment Partnership, matching members at similar career stages to share resources, accountability, and lived-experience strategies.
  • Community Building: Organize "Peer Circles" or virtual meetups specifically for participants in the partnership program to share collective successes and challenges.
  • Feedback Loops: Implement surveys (via Google Forms or similar tools) to continuously improve the peer-to-peer matching algorithm and program structure.

Operational Support & Reporting:

  • Database Management: Maintain accurate records of all participants, active matches, and program alumni using BPN’s internal tracking systems (primarily Excel and Google Sheets).
  • Impact Metrics: Collect data and testimonials to measure the success of the programs, providing regular reports to Executive Leadership for grant reporting and marketing.
  • Conflict Resolution: Serve as the primary point of contact for any issues or mismatches within the mentorship or peer partnerships, providing mediation and re-matching as needed.

Collaboration & Advocacy:

  • Marketing Liaison: Work with the Communications team to promote the programs and recruit new mentors from diverse professional backgrounds.
  • Accessibility Oversight: Ensure all program materials, matching forms, and communication channels are fully accessible to screen reader users and those with low vision.

Qualifications

  • Proven experience in program management, human resources, coaching, or a related field.
  • Technical Proficiency: Advanced skills in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el,) and Google Workspace (Docs, Sheets, Drive, Forms) are required for data tracking and document creation.
  • Strong interpersonal and relationship-building skills; ability to communicate effectively with professionals at all levels.
  • Exceptional organizational skills and attention to detail, particularly in managing data and tracking multiple relationships simultaneously.
  • Familiarity with the unique professional challenges faced by the BVI community.
  • Proficiency with virtual collaboration tools (Zoom, Google Meet).
  • Personal commitment to BPN’s mission and a passion for fostering professional growth within the disability community.

Reporting Structure

This position reports to the Program Manager.

Time Commitment

This is a volunteer position requiring an estimated commitment of 8–10 hours per week, with flexibility needed for participant check-ins and monthly leadership meetings.
